Notts County striker Gavin Gordon could miss the rest of the season after suffering a broken jaw in the 1-1 draw with Rushden & Diamonds.
The 25-year-old was stretchered off after half an hour of the Meadow Lane encounter on Saturday and Magpies player-manager Ian Richardson fears the worst.
He told the club's official website: "I've spoken to the surgeon and Gavin's broken his jaw and could be out for the rest of the season."
Gordon joined County at the start of the season on a free transfer from Cardiff City and has scored eight goals in 32 appearances for the Magpies.
